How the Calling System Works
Storii places three automated calls per week at times you choose. When your grandparent picks up, they hear a prompt question and can record their answer verbally. The system works with any phone, including old landlines, which makes it accessible for grandparents who do not own smartphones.
You can log in to the Storii portal anytime to listen to recordings, read transcriptions, and add your own questions. Family members can be invited to contribute, making it a collaborative family history project.

Outdoor Placement Tips
For best solar charging results, place the turtle where it will receive 6 to 8 hours of direct sunlight daily. South-facing garden spots or open patio areas work best. Avoid placing it under dense tree cover or roof overhangs that block sunlight.
In areas with heavy snow or extreme weather, consider bringing it indoors during the harshest months to extend its lifespan. The solar panel should be wiped clean occasionally to maintain charging efficiency.
Battery Life and Solar Performance
A full day of sunlight charges the battery enough for up to 10 hours of illumination. In practice, you can expect 6 to 8 hours of light on most nights, depending on how much sun the panel received during the day. The lights turn off automatically when the battery depletes.
The rechargeable battery is designed for hundreds of charge cycles. If it eventually stops holding a charge, the battery can be replaced, extending the life of the statue indefinitely.

How It Helps with Arthritis
The long handle is the key feature for arthritis sufferers. By extending the lever arm, the opener multiplies the force applied, meaning less hand strength is needed. The rubber grip surface reduces the amount of pinching and squeezing required compared to twisting a lid by hand.
For grandparents with moderate arthritis, this tool can be the difference between asking for help and doing it themselves. It is a small dignity that adds up across hundreds of jars opened over a year.

What is the 5 gift rule?
The 5 gift rule is a popular gifting strategy where you give someone five specific categories: something they want, something they need, something to wear, something to read, and something they do not know they want. For grandparents, this might mean a massager (want), a jar opener (need), a poncho blanket (wear), a legacy journal (read), and a smart bird feeder (surprise they didn’t know they wanted).
